简体   繁体   English

如何检查是否使用JavaScript检查了单选按钮?

[英]How do I check if a radio button is checked using JavaScript?

When I select a radio button then click the download button, nothing happens. 当我选择一个单选按钮然后单击下载按钮时,什么也没有发生。 No alert shows up or anything. 没有任何警报显示。

Here is my code right now: 现在是我的代码:

HTML: HTML:

<form id="Resume_Select">
<input type="radio" name="resume_type" value="Economics" >Economics
<br />
<input type="radio" name="resume_type" value="MIS" >Management Information Systems
<br />
<button onClick="resume_select()"> Download</button>
</form>

JavaScript: JavaScript的:

<script>
    function resume_select(){
    var radios = document.getElementByName('resume_type');
    for(var i = 0, length = radios.length; i<length;i++){

        if(radios[i].checked){
            var resume = radios[i].value;
            alert(radios[i].value);
            break;
        }
    }

</script>

It should be getElementsByName plural not getElementByName. 应该是getElementsByName复数形式,而不是getElementByName。 First thing that jumped at me. 跳到我身上的第一件事。

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M